Ratkovac (Orahovac)
Ratkovac, 'Ratkoc' or 'Ratkoci' (Albanian: Drinas), is a small village in Kosovo. The village is about 12 km (7 mi), by road, from the city of Gjakova, but only 2 km (1 mi) by geographical distance. The name Ratkovac means Place of a warrior in serbian, derived from the Serbian word rat, which means war.

99% of inhabitants of this village are ethnic Albanian and 1% are declared as minority, but speak Albanian as their only language.
